I Built a PTE Core Platform While Preparing for Canada PR
A competitive CRS score is crucial for Canada PR, with language proficiency being a significant factor. Initially, IELTS and CELPIP were the main English tests, but resources lacked clear guidance on achieving high scores. The launch of PTE Core in 2024 offered a machine-scored alternative, appealing to those who prefer measurable practice. However, the PTE Core preparation landscape was underdeveloped, with most resources catering to PTE Academic and not fully relevant for immigration candidates. Recognizing this gap, the founder created Phrasel, a platform and community specifically for Canadian immigration aspirants.Phrasel focuses on PTE Core, understanding the unique goals and score thresholds for immigration, unlike generic English exams. The platform prioritizes clarity over an overwhelming volume of practice materials, aiming to identify specific areas for improvement. Its core philosophy is that learners need diagnostic feedback to guide their next steps, rather than just more questions or rigid templates. Phrasel integrates Canada PR specific tools, such as CLB conversion and CRS points, directly into its practice workflow.The platform offers exam-style practice across all four skills, with AI scoring for speaking and writing providing detailed feedback. Full-length mock tests are available, designed to pinpoint strengths and weaknesses for targeted study. Phrasel emphasizes building real language ability over relying on shortcuts or memorized templates, believing that genuine skill development leads to lasting scores. The AI scoring, while a valuable training signal, is presented honestly as a refinement tool rather than a guaranteed predictor of official Pearson scores. Phrasel's development stack includes Next.js, React, Vite, Flask, and AI services for scoring. The founder believes that clear feedback and understanding which skill is hindering progress are key to effective preparation.
